Output 8e35cf158e1fdeb26d6744ff1328de04a005085d65fcc603085fcac9a803d63f:1

value
255842821
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5a84f7d174989ba6729f8786a03803132b8773bcaac9967372fc33ceb11bac67
address
tb1pt2z005t5nzd6vu5ls7r2qwqrzv4cwuau4tyevumjlseuavgm43ns4pp5fy
transaction
8e35cf158e1fdeb26d6744ff1328de04a005085d65fcc603085fcac9a803d63f
confirmations
159520
spent
true